Overview of Cancellation Policy
Bus companies have different rules for canceling tickets. For example, Aquaholic Tourist Caravan has a clear policy. Cancel at least 48 hours before for a full refund. Cancel between 24 to 48 hours for a 15% deduction. And, cancel less than 24 hours before, and you won’t get a refund.
Group bookings need a 60% advance payment to secure seats. Cancel seven days before for a full refund. Cancel between 72 hours to seven days before for a 15% deduction. And, cancel less than 72 hours before, and you won’t get a refund.

Refund Policy for Cox’s Bazar Bus Ticket
It’s key to know the refund policy for Cox’s Bazar bus tickets. This policy explains when and how you can get a refund after canceling your ticket. Each bus company has its own rules for refunds, so it’s good to be informed.
Refunds are usually not given unless you cancel your ticket according to the bus company’s rules. You must send your refund request to [email protected] within a set time. If you miss this deadline, you might not get your refund.
For non-Eid periods, you need to cancel your ticket within a specific time frame. The time allowed for cancellation varies from 12 to 36 hours. Remember, if you don’t show up 20 minutes before your trip, your ticket is canceled, and no refund is given.
Refunds for non-Eid periods can take 1 to 2 weeks to show up in your account. This applies to payments made by credit card, debit card, or internet banking. The Shohoz.com convenience fee might also be refundable during non-Eid times but not during Eid.
There are cases where you might get a refund, like if you paid too much or had trouble getting your ticket. You need to make these claims quickly, following the set deadlines. By following these refund conditions, you’re more likely to get your money back quickly.

Refund Process During Eid Period
During Eid travel, knowing how to get a refund is key. The Eid cancellation policy can be confusing. Refunds are mainly for when the bus operator cancels the trip.
To get a refund, follow these steps:
- Check if your trip was canceled by the operator.
- Have your ticket number and contact info ready.
- Send a refund request through the operator’s channels.
Refunds during Eid might take longer because of many requests. It’s best to ask for a refund quickly after the trip is canceled.
For more details, see the table below. It shows how Eid cancellation policy works:
| Scenario | Refund Eligibility | Processing Time |
|---|---|---|
| Operator cancels trip | Yes | 5-10 Business Days |
| Customer requests cancellation | No | N/A |
| Trip operated as scheduled | No | N/A |
Knowing the refund process and Eid cancellation policy helps with travel plans. Keep up with your bus operator’s updates to understand your rights during Eid.
